My husband and I recently bought a house and we needed to furnish it all, I mean, including the stove, fridge, etc. I decided to make an appointment with them to see what it was all about. After hours of talking of how much money you would save if you join them they break down how much you have to pay for the membership, which is actually 5,000 that you can pay in installments IF you leave at least 500-700 upfront. You do not have a second opportunity to join them, not even a day to think about it, they heat up your head and make you decide that same day. In order for you to save thousands like they say, you would have to spend hundreds of thousands.It's a rip off
